Output 65f839100a9b0eca0ce0029c2bc9b26a123b0c3d419d33bb7c47fc0fc33468f3:0

value
1043660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a9eb5708bb0da7c2c744addb2926128e4e1951 OP_EQUAL
address
3MSdSBKsp23nZowVS3e2NWUkNRJtHSv9Xp
transaction
65f839100a9b0eca0ce0029c2bc9b26a123b0c3d419d33bb7c47fc0fc33468f3